Guwahati Ring Road gets Rs 57.3B push to ease traffic, boost logistics

The National Highways Authority of India (NHAI) has awarded a Rs 57.3 billion contract for the construction of the 121-km Guwahati Ring Road, a long-pending project aimed at easing traffic and improving regional connectivity across Assam. The agreement was signed with Infracon Pvt Ltd under the DBFOT model, with a 30-year concession period, including four years for construction.

Work is expected to begin after the 2025 monsoon, with the ring road designed to divert freight and inter-state traffic away from the city. The project will be developed in three phases—starting with a 55.54-km greenfield corridor from Baihata Chariali to Sonapur, followed by the widening of a 7.76-km NH-27 stretch, and capped by the upgrade of another 58 km of NH-27, along with a 3-km Brahmaputra bridge.

The project is expected to decongest Guwahati, reduce pollution, and enhance logistics efficiency across the Northeast. It also aligns with the Gati Shakti plan, aiming to boost multimodal transport and expand market access in the region.

InsideFPV Delivers ₹10 Crore Kamikaze Drone Order Under MoD’s EPR Route

InsideFPV, a Surat-based drone technology manufacturer, has successfully executed a ₹10 crore defence contract to supply indigenous kamikaze drones under the Ministry of Defence’s Emergency Procurement Route (EPR). The company completed the delivery of hundreds of FPV kamikaze drone platforms within a rapid two-month timeframe, highlighting its ability to meet urgent military procurement timelines.The supply orders were fulfilled under the emergency procurement mechanism, which is aimed at fast-tracking acquisitions for immediate operational needs. Vedanta Resources Secures Fitch Upgrade to ‘BB-’, Best Rating Since 2015

Vedanta Resources Limited (VRL), a global player in metals, oil & gas, critical minerals, power and technology, has received a credit rating upgrade from Fitch Ratings, marking its strongest bond rating in over a decade.Fitch has raised Vedanta Resources’ Long-Term Foreign-Currency Issuer Default Rating (IDR) to ‘BB-’ from ‘B+’, while maintaining a Stable Outlook.
